What you’ll see is around 10 minutes of gameplay at Miller Park (which has actually been changed since this video was shot.) This is as close to direct-feed that we could get, so the quality is a bit less than perfect. Also, the audio was removed completely as all you could hear was us idiots talking in the background. This is NOT FINAL CODE, and was actually changing throughout the week that we were there. Some things to focus on are the updated player models (no more T-Rex) and the analog controls.
